To properly charge the Stihl AR 2000 L battery, connect the charger to a power outlet, attach the battery to the charger, and ensure the charging indicator light is on. It is recommended to charge at temperatures between 41°F and 104°F (5°C to 40°C).
If your Stihl AR 3000 L does not start, check if the battery is fully charged, ensure that the battery is properly connected, and inspect for any visible damage. If the problem persists, consult the user manual or contact an authorized service center.
The Stihl AR 2000 L is designed to be splash-proof, but it is not waterproof. Avoid using it in heavy rain or submerging it in water to prevent damage.
To extend the battery life of your Stihl AR 3000 L, store it in a cool, dry place, avoid extreme temperatures, and do not leave it fully charged or fully discharged for extended periods. Regularly use and recharge the battery to maintain its health.
Regular maintenance for the Stihl AR 2000 L includes cleaning the battery contacts and casing with a dry cloth, checking for any damage or wear, and ensuring proper storage conditions. Avoid exposure to moisture and extreme temperatures.
When storing the Stihl AR 3000 L for long periods, charge the battery to about 50%, store it in a dry and cool environment, and check the charge level every few months to prevent deep discharge.
The recommended usage temperature range for the Stihl AR 2000 L is between 14°F and 122°F (-10°C to 50°C). Using the battery within this range ensures optimal performance and longevity.
The Stihl AR 3000 L is fully charged when the charging indicator on the charger displays a steady green light. Refer to the charger manual for specific indicator information.
It is not recommended to repair the Stihl AR 2000 L battery yourself due to safety concerns and warranty issues. Contact an authorized Stihl service center for repairs.
If your Stihl AR 3000 L battery overheats, immediately turn off the device and allow the battery to cool in a well-ventilated area. Ensure it is not exposed to direct sunlight or heat sources. If overheating persists, seek professional assistance.
